How they compare
Montenegro currently reports 45.1% against 45.1% in Saint Kitts and Nevis, a difference of 0.0%.
The two have swapped places 1 time across 30 shared years of data; in 1990 it was Montenegro ahead.
Montenegro ranks 24th and Saint Kitts and Nevis ranks 24th of 192 countries.
Montenegro has averaged higher in every one of the 3 decades both report.
Head to head by decade
| Decade | Montenegro | Saint Kitts and Nevis | Difference | Ahead |
|---|---|---|---|---|
| 1990s | 46.2% | 40.1% | 6.1% | Montenegro |
| 2000s | 44.9% | 43.1% | 1.7% | Montenegro |
| 2010s | 45.1% | 45.0% | 0.1% | Montenegro |
Averages of every year both report within each decade.

About this data
Prevalence of hypertension is the percentage of adults ages 30-79 with hypertension (defined as having systolic blood pressure =140 mmHg, diastolic blood pressure =90 mmHg, or taking medication for hypertension). The data is age-standardized.
